Figure 4.
Survival of xenograft mice with EBV-associated lymphoproliferative disorder. First, 1.0 × 107 human cord mononuclear blood cells were each infected with 1.0 × 104 viruses (WT, dCp) and immediately transplanted intraperitoneally into NOG mice (n = 6). (A,B) Survival ratio (A) and body weight (B) of the mice were plotted. (C,D) Microscopic images of H-E staining of tumors in the pancreas of the mice infected with WT (C) or dCp (D) virus.
